提高采集效率!火车头采集技术维护解析

优采云 发布时间: 2023-04-27 23:29

  火车头采集技术是一种高效的数据采集方式,可以帮助企业快速获取所需数据。然而,随着数据量的增加和采集方式的多样化,火车头采集技术也面临着诸多挑战。本文将从多个方面对火车头采集技术的维护进行详细分析,并提供实用的解决方案。

  1.了解采集目标

  在进行火车头采集之前,首先需要明确采集目标。通过了解目标网站的页面结构、数据类型、数据量等信息,可以更好地制定采集策略。同时,也需要注意网站的反爬机制,避免被封IP。

  2.优化爬虫代码

  爬虫代码是火车头采集技术的核心部分。为了提高采集效率和稳定性,需要对代码进行优化。例如,使用多线程或异步IO方式进行数据请求和处理、设置合理的请求间隔时间、增加异常处理等。

  3.遵守网站规则

  在进行火车头采集时,需要遵守目标网站的相关规则,如robots.txt文件中的规定、网站反爬机制等。否则可能会被封IP,甚至引发法律风险。

  4.使用代理IP

  为了避免被封IP,可以使用代理IP进行采集。代理IP可以隐藏真实IP地址,避免被目标网站识别出来。同时,也需要注意代理IP的稳定性和质量。

  5.数据存储与清洗

  采集到的数据需要进行存储和清洗。通常可以使用数据库、文件等方式进行数据存储。同时,也需要对采集到的数据进行清洗、去重、格式化等操作,以便后续分析和使用。

  6.防止反爬机制

  

  为了防止被目标网站的反爬机制识别出来,可以采取一些措施,如模拟人类行为、随机请求头、使用验证码识别等。同时,也需要定期更新代码以适应目标网站的变化。

  7.数据处理与分析

  采集到的数据需要进行处理和分析,以便得出有用的信息。例如,可以使用数据挖掘、机器学习等技术对数据进行处理和分析,并提取出有价值的信息。

  8.保护个人隐私

  在进行火车头采集时,需要注意保护个人隐私。例如,在采集涉及个人隐私的数据时,需要遵守相关法律法规,并采取相应措施保护个人隐私。

  9.优化采集效率

  为了提高采集效率,可以使用一些技巧。例如,可以选择合适的采集工具、增加采集线程数、使用分布式架构等方式提高采集效率。

  10. SEO优化

  在进行火车头采集时,也需要注意SEO优化。例如,在采集网站的同时,可以对网站进行关键词优化、页面优化等操作,以提高网站在搜索引擎中的排名。

  综上所述,火车头采集技术在数据采集中具有重要作用。为了保证其稳定性和效率,需要从多个方面进行维护。本文提供的解决方案可以帮助企业更好地进行火车头采集,并获取更多有价值的信息。

  (本文由优采云提供支持,优采云是一家专业的数据采集平台,致力于为企业提供高效、稳定、安全的数据采集服务。了解更多信息,请访问www.ucaiyun.

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线